On 20.03.2017 11:42, Philipp Zabel wrote:
> When RESET_CONTROLLER is not enabled, the optional reset_control_get
> stubs should now also return NULL.
>
> Fixes: bb475230b8e5 ("reset: make optional functions really optional")
> Reported-by: Andrzej Hajda <[email protected]>
> Cc: Ramiro Oliveira <[email protected]>
> Signed-off-by: Philipp Zabel <[email protected]>
> ---
>  include/linux/reset.h | 4 ++--
>  1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/include/linux/reset.h b/include/linux/reset.h
> index 86b4ed75359e8..c905ff1c21ec6 100644
> --- a/include/linux/reset.h
> +++ b/include/linux/reset.h
> @@ -74,14 +74,14 @@ static inline struct reset_control 
> *__of_reset_control_get(
>                                       const char *id, int index, bool shared,
>                                       bool optional)
>  {
> -     return ERR_PTR(-ENOTSUPP);
> +     return optional ? NULL : ERR_PTR(-ENOTSUPP);
>  }
>  
>  static inline struct reset_control *__devm_reset_control_get(
>                                       struct device *dev, const char *id,
>                                       int index, bool shared, bool optional)
>  {
> -     return ERR_PTR(-ENOTSUPP);
> +     return optional ? NULL : ERR_PTR(-ENOTSUPP);
>  }
>  
>  #endif /* CONFIG_RESET_CONTROLLER */


Such change should be accompanied with change of all other stub
functions to accept NULL reset_control without displaying WARNs.
